The five goals of communicating negative information are to gain acceptance for the bad news, maintain goodwill, maintain a positive image, offer alternatives, and provide an opportunity to discuss the issue further. Option A specifically addresses the goal of gaining acceptance for bad news by presenting it in a way that is easily digestible and minimizing negative reactions.
